Key findings
Tribunal's reasoningThe claimant had been ordered to pay a deposit of £250 after a preliminary hearing held on 23 April 2020. The order was sent to him on 7 May 2020.
The claimant failed to pay the deposit. The tribunal therefore struck out the complaint, described as a complaint that the respondent discriminated against him by denying him the opportunity to receive a service, under rule 39(4) of the Employment Tribunals Rules of Procedure 2013.
